Wagering Requirements: The Hidden Tax on Free Chips

Every free chip comes with a wagering requirement. That is the number of times you must wager the chip amount before you can withdraw any winnings. The standard range is 30x to 40x. A $10 chip with a 35x requirement means you need to wager $350. If the pokie has a 96% RTP, your expected loss on that wagering is $14. The chip is worth $10. You are expected to lose $4 more than the chip’s value. That is a negative expected value proposition.

Some operators offer lower wagering requirements. Richard Casino has a 30x requirement on some chips. That reduces the expected loss to $12. Still negative, but less punishing. Stay Casino offers a 35x requirement on their $10 chip. The expected loss is $14. The chip is worth $10. You are down $4. The only way to come out ahead is to hit a lucky streak that exceeds the expected loss. That is possible, but improbable over a large sample size.

We calculated the probability of turning a $10 chip into a withdrawable balance. Assuming a 96% RTP and a 35x wagering requirement, the probability of ending with a positive balance after wagering is around 20%. That means 80% of players will lose their chip value. The house edge is not just on the pokies. It is baked into the wagering requirement itself.

Max-Bet Rules and Game Restrictions

Most free chips come with a max-bet rule. You cannot wager more than $5 per spin while using the chip. This is a standard safeguard to prevent players from grinding the requirement with high-variance bets. It also means you cannot use the chip on progressive jackpot pokies or high-volatility games. The restriction limits your potential upside. If you hit a big win on a low-volatility game, the payout is smaller. The max-bet rule is a subtle way to reduce the chip’s value.

Game restrictions are another hidden tax. Some chips are only valid on specific pokies, often the ones with lower RTPs. We found that National Casino’s free chip is restricted to a set of pokies with an average RTP of 94%. That is 2% lower than the market average. The expected loss on the wagering requirement jumps from $14 to $16. The chip’s value drops by another 20%. Always check the eligible games before claiming.
